Causes of Tractor Trailer Truck Accidents
According to the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ration, tractor-trailer truck accidents happen for many reasons, but some of the more typical causes of accidents include:
- Overloaded or improperly loaded trucks.
- Unreasonable schedules.
- Driver fatigue.
- Poorly maintained trucks.
- Unsafe turns.
- Jackknife accidents.
- Defective equipment.
- Driving under the influence of drugs or alcohol.
- Driver inexperience or lack of training.
- Negligent or reckless driving.
- Speeding.
- Defective roadways or hazards in the roadways.
- Dangerous weather conditions.

Potentially Recoverable Compensation
If you suffered injuries or damages related to a tractor-trailer truck accident, you may incur extensive medical bills along with lost wages and a loss of earning capacity, which may qualify you for compensation. Aside from your physical pain, mental anguish, or disfigurement, you may also qualify for compensation for prescription medications, transportation costs, or even accommodations to your home, such as wheelchair ramps, stairlifts, or shower rails.
If your loved one died due to a tractor-trailer truck accident, you may have the right to file a wrongful death claim. You may receive funds for funeral expenses, lost wages that your loved one would have contributed to your family, the loss of consortium (your relationship with your loved one), mental suffering, and medical bills incurred before your loved one’s death.
Finally, you may have the opportunity to claim punitive damages in the state of Illinois. A court awards punitive compensation when it deems the behavior of the other party so egregious that it wants to make an example of them and punish their behavior by awarding additional monetary damages to the plaintiff. If the behavior of the driver, company, mechanic, or manufacturer proves egregious enough, you may have the right to seek punitive damages.

Types of Lawsuits
If you had an accident with a tractor-trailer truck, you have the option to file different types of lawsuits depending on who has liability and responsibility for the accident.
Personal Injury
If a negligent driver operated the tractor-trailer truck while under the influence of drugs or alcohol, was speeding, felt fatigued, had an overloaded truck, or drove the truck recklessly, you may have the ability to file a lawsuit against the driver, too. If a company employs the driver, you may also be able to sue the company. If a technician or mechanic failed to service the truck correctly, you could pursue compensation from them.
Wrongful Death
If your loved one died as a result of a tractor-trailer truck accident, you may have the right to file a wrongful death claim on their behalf. Close relatives of the victim may be able to sue for funeral and burial costs, medical bills, loss of wages, loss of consortium, and loss of future wages.
Product Liability
If the manufacturer of the tractor-trailer truck placed a defective part or component onto the truck that caused the accident, you may have the right to file a product liability case against that manufacturer.
Government Lawsuits
Government agencies must keep the roadways safe for travel. If the government neglected to keep a road safe by failing to fix a pothole or leaving debris after a construction or work project, you may be able to hold that government agency responsible. Filing a lawsuit against the government requires an entirely different approach and comes with different deadlines as well.
